About Kew 2439

The size of Kew is approximately 20.8 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 4.6% of total area. The population of Kew in 2016 was 1089 people. By 2021 the population was 1761 showing a population growth of 61.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kew is 70-79 years. Households in Kew are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kew work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 77.60% of the homes in Kew were owner-occupied compared with 87.30% in 2016.

Kew has 994 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Kew have seen a 37.91% increase in median value.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Kew is $847,135 while the median value for Units is $668,616.
  • Houses have a median rent of $530.
There are currently 8 properties listed for sale, and no properties listed for rent in Kew on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 31 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Kew.
